I don't mean to drag the telemarketer thing on any further, but I found this in 
the San Francisco Weekly (24 Apr 91) about Private Citizen Inc, who "... 
compiles a list of citizens who are fed up with telemarketers, and sends these 
names to more than 750 telemarketing firms twice a year. The firms are made an 
offer to use individuals' phone time on a 'for hire' basis only; a 'junk call' 
to a listed consumer constitutes acceptance of an obligation to pay $100 to the 
consumer.

"According to [founder Robert] Bulmash, it works -- subscribers report an 80 
percent drop in telemarketing calls, and a number of consumers have collected 
their $100 fee for being harrassed.

" 'I encourage subscribers to tell me about telemarketing firms that aren't on 
my list,', says Bulmash. 'We get the big guys, but there are still a lot of 
local places that we don't know about'.

"To be listed in the Private Citizen Directory, the fee is $20 annually.
